Why do eggs float? I learned from the computer: When the egg is first put into the water, because the specific gravity of the egg is greater than that of water, the buoyancy force on the egg is less than its own weight, so it will It sinks to the bottom; after adding salt, the water dissolves the salt, and the specific gravity of the water increases. When the specific gravity of the salt water is equal to the specific gravity of the egg, the egg will float in the middle of the water; continue to add salt, when the specific gravity of the salt water is greater than the egg. When the specific gravity is high, the egg will float on top of the salt water, with the top of the egg sticking out of the water.
The teacher told us in class: Any object in water will experience a buoyant force, and the magnitude of the buoyant force is equal to the weight of the volume of water displaced by the object. This is the famous "Archimedes' Law", also It's called the law of buoyancy. In fact, science is similar to the physics you need to learn when you grow up.

The eyes are known as the windows to the soul. They are the first of the five senses and one of the most important organs in the human body. For people Our work, study and life are all very important. Everyone hopes to have a pair of beautiful and piercing eyes, but it is not easy to protect your eyes.
Primary school students should protect their eyes from myopia, mainly by having correct reading and writing postures, keeping a distance of more than 30 centimeters between their eyes and books, and not reading under strong sunlight or too dark light. Don't read while walking or riding in a car, don't read while lying down or lying on your stomach, and don't read and write for too long. Our school has launched activities to allow children to have enough time outdoors to protect our eyesight. In addition, we must persist in Do good eye care exercises, and also look out the window or look at some green plants. Do not watch TV programs, operate computers or play electronic games for a long time; now more and more people are using computers for work and study. Even our primary school students should go online and play online games for a while after finishing their homework, but do not exceed For an hour, maintain the most appropriate posture. The distance between the eyes and the screen should be 40-50 centimeters. Make your eyes look straight or slightly downward at the screen. This can relax the neck muscles and reduce the exposed area of ??the eyeballs to At the very least, the lighting in the computer room should be appropriate and should not be too bright or too dark. You can also protect your eyes by setting the screen hue, saturation, and brightness. The posture when using the computer is also very important. Use a chair that can be adjusted in height so that the operator is at the same level as the center of the computer screen. There should be enough space for your feet when sitting, and do not cross your feet to avoid affecting blood circulation.
People who often use computers are prone to "dry eye syndrome". That is, when we use computers for a long time, people will feel eye fatigue, blurred vision, dry or congested eyes, photophobia, soreness and even loss of vision. The light gathering ability of the eye. If you have dry eyes, redness, burning or foreign body sensation, heavy eyelids, blurred vision, or even eyeball pain or headache, you need to go to the hospital to see an ophthalmologist.
I saw on the Internet that when computer operators work long hours in front of a fluorescent screen, the rhodopsin on the retina will be consumed, and rhodopsin is mainly synthesized from vitamin A. Eat more foods rich in vitamin A. Foods such as animal liver, carrots, tomatoes, sweet potatoes, spinach, pea shoots, etc. To protect your eyes, you can also work hard on your diet. Eating more fresh vegetables is also very beneficial to protecting your eyes, preventing and treating eye diseases, and improving your vision.
